Union Budget FY 22-23 in terms of Toll, Roads and Highways

Since Toll and ITS has a good amount of share in the new road networks and highways getting built-up, we as an Industry, are very confident in our growth and as Tecsidel, being one of the leaders in Toll and ITS. We also feel confident in the growth  of our business in tolling and Advance Traffic Management System as the increase in the road networks and highways positively impacts our business. The more highways are built, the more technology deployed and the more share we have for our industry.
As compared to the last budget, this budget is highly progressive in terms of Tecsidel’ s business market as there’s a hike of ₹81,006 crore.
Of the 35 multi-modal logistics parks the government plans across the country, four will be awarded in the next fiscal which is looking bright for Tecsidel as Tecsidel is already expanding its horizons and entering logistics and parking solutions as well.
The FM Nirmala Sitharaman said that the PM Gati Shakti Master Plan for Expressways will be formulated in 2022-23 to facilitate the faster movement of people and goods. Road Transport and Highways Minister Nitin Gadkari is also very keen for Toll free Highways (Free Flow Solutions where there will be no physical toll Plazas and no stoppage). Tecsidel, being a leader in Free flow, sees a huge business potential in this segment as well.
The gist of the budget is that increase & development of highways and logistics parks definitely means a boost in tolling and parking & logistics solutions which in turn means a high flow of business towards our Tolling and ITS Industry and we are already a part of this.
